The Enduring USB 2.0 Interface and Modern Adaptability
Connectivity for the UTHAI X05 is managed through a ubiquitous
USB 2.0 interface, featuring an attached cable with a practical length of 100mm (approximately 4 inches). This widely adopted standard guarantees broad compatibility with an immense array of computing devices, ranging from older desktop PCs to contemporary
laptops. USB 2.0 remains a cornerstone of peripheral connectivity.
While USB 2.0 provides more than sufficient bandwidth for the data transfer requirements of smart card operations, which are typically low-speed and burst-oriented, it is important to acknowledge that it is not the fastest USB standard available today. For applications demanding high-speed, large-volume data transfers beyond the scope of smart card reading, this might represent a minor limitation. However, for its intended purpose, USB 2.0 is perfectly adequate. Smart card data transfer is minimal.
Unlike newer USB 3.0 or the latest USB-C interfaces that boast significantly higher data transfer rates, USB 2.0 maintains its status as a universally reliable and exceptionally ubiquitous standard. Its widespread adoption ensures immediate plug-and-play functionality across virtually all operating systems and hardware generations. This inherent compatibility greatly simplifies the setup process, eliminating the need for complex driver installations.

Optimized Ergonomics and Unmatched Portability
Weighing a mere
24 grams, the UTHAI X05 is exceptionally lightweight, making it almost imperceptible in a bag or pocket. Its precise dimensions of 64mm x 64mm (approximately 2.5 inches x 2.5 inches) with a slender thickness of 0.85mm (0.03 inches) contribute to its remarkably compact profile. This combination of minimal weight and small footprint renders it highly portable.

Mitigating Digital Vulnerabilities: A Holistic Approach
While the UTHAI X05 itself provides a secure hardware interface for smart card interaction, a "Backup Paranoid" perspective necessitates acknowledging that no single component can guarantee absolute digital security. Users must remain acutely vigilant about the broader software environment in which the device operates. The presence of malware, viruses, or outdated operating system software on the host computer can still compromise data, regardless of the reader's inherent security features. Device security is one critical layer.
This editorial stance dictates that a comprehensive security strategy extends beyond the hardware itself. The UTHAI X05 effectively facilitates secure hardware interaction with the smart card chip. However, robust user practices, including regular software updates, the use of reputable antivirus solutions, and adherence to strong password policies, are equally vital in establishing an impenetrable digital perimeter.
Unlike solutions that rely exclusively on software-based security measures, the physical interaction with an IC card via a dedicated hardware reader introduces a tangible and highly effective layer of protection. This method significantly reduces remote attack vectors and makes it considerably more difficult for malicious software to intercept or manipulate transaction data. It creates a physical barrier.
